[МАТЛАБ] оптерећење линије вектора одвојено (Од матрица фајл)

D

davyzhu

Guest
Поздрав свима, имам фајл садржи неколико линија вектора (све цифра је у АСЦИИ моду). Датотеке садржај као што су испод, сваки ред је вектор (нешто попут користите саве-асции да сачувате матрица): 1 2 3 4 5 6 7 8 9 10 6 7 8 9 10 1 2 3 4 5 4 5 6 7 8 1 2 3 ... 9, 10 ... Али мој прави вектор сваку линију је 1 * 2000, и ја сам 4000 линије вектора (тј. 4000 * 2000 матрице). Дакле, вектор је сувише велики да учита све вектори (тј. фајл матрица) за ЛОАД-асции команду. Како да посебно оптерећење сваку линију вектора? односно оптерећење лине1 вектор -> оптерећења лине2 вектор -> ... до последње линије вектора Све у свему, желим петљу која чита једну линију из фајла по петљи итерације. Хвала! Рицхард
 
Шта није у реду са ради ово? фоо = оптерећење ('мидата'), да ради добро са фајла који садржи 2000к4000 бројева. Резултат матрица дубл троши 64 мегабајта. Ако то није оно што желите, молимо Вас да објасни боље "оптерећење сваку линију векторске одвојено".
 
Здраво ецхо47, ја сам збуњен са овим радом ;-) Учитавам матрице троши превише меморије. И оптерећења свих матрица није неопходно за мој посао. Свака линија матрице је кодна реч је добио са канала. Па морам да декодирају кодне речи сваки пут (није потребно оптерећења све кодне речи). Дакле, оно што желим се бави редовима матрице (тј. ред вектор матрице). На пример, у тиме1, оптерећења ред 1 из матрице датотеке, декодирање реч код 1 на време2, оптерећења ред 2 из матрице датотеке, декодирање реч код 2; ... ... Извини за моје лоше преведеном енглеском језику, Срдацан поздрав, Дејви
 
Аххх ... чита једну линију по петљи итерације! Да ли је то оно што сте имали на уму? [Цоде] фин = фопен ("мидата '), док ~ феоф (фин) фоо = ссцанф (фгетл (Фин),'% д ', [1 инф]); дисп (ФОО),% заменити ове са вашим парсирање код крају фцлосе (пераја); [/ цоде]
 

Welcome to EDABoard.com

Sponsor

Back
Top